All I can say is that with 10 degrees of flaps, ROC as measured by VSI is about 100 fpm better in my typical flight environments. Aviation Consumer, as well as the AA-5 owners I've spoken to, say the following:
"Takeoff and climb performance can be enhanced by ignoring book procedures, which call for flaps up. Some experienced Tiger/Cheetah pilots put down about one-third flaps when takeoff performance is critical."
